DataTransfer | The DataTransfer object is used to hold the data that is being dragged during a drag and drop operation. |
DataTransferItem | The DataTransferItem object represents one drag data item. During a drag operation, each drag event has a dataTransfer property which contains a list of drag data items. Each item in the list is a DataTransferItem object. |
DataTransferItemList | The DataTransferItemList object is a list of DataTransferItem objects representing items being dragged. During a drag operation, each DragEvent has a dataTransfer property and that property is a DataTransferItemList. |
DoubleClickEvent | The |
DragDropEvent | The drop event is fired when an element or text selection is dropped on a valid drop target. |
DragEndEvent | The dragend event is fired when a drag operation is being ended (by releasing a mouse button or hitting the escape key). |
DragEnterEvent | The dragenter event is fired when a dragged element or text selection enters a valid drop target. |
DragEvent | The drag event is fired every few hundred milliseconds as an element or text selection is being dragged by the user. |
DragExitEvent | The dragexit event is fired when an element is no longer the drag operation's immediate selection target. |
DragLeaveEvent | The dragleave event is fired when a dragged element or text selection leaves a valid drop target. |
DragOverEvent | The dragover event is fired when an element or text selection is being dragged over a valid drop target (every few hundred milliseconds). |
DragRelatedEvent | A reference to a JavaScript object which implements the IDragEvent interface. |
DragStartEvent | The dragstart event is fired when the user starts dragging an element or text selection. |
